Maggie Roswell (born November 14, 1952) is an American actress. She got both an Annie Award and an Emmy Award. She voiced the characters Maude Flanders, Miss Hoover, Helen Lovejoy, and Luann Van Houten in the animated series The Simpsons. She got her acting break during the 1980s in movies including Lost in America and Pretty in Pink.[1]
The actress was born in Los Angeles, California.
